German Potato Salad Recipe

German Potato Salad features boiled red potatoes combined with a warm dressing made from bacon drippings, diced bacon, sautéed onions, vinegar, sugar, water, celery seed, salt, and coarse black pepper. The mixture is tossed with fresh parsley for a tangy, savory side dish with a balanced sweet and acidic flavor and tender yet firm potatoes.

Description

This potato salad starts by boiling red potatoes until tender but not falling apart. Separately, diced bacon is cooked until crispy, then drained except for 4 tablespoons of fat used to sauté diced onions until just browned. A dressing is prepared by adding white vinegar, water, sugar, salt, celery seed, and pepper to the pan and heating until boiling and sugar is dissolved.

The hot dressing is poured over the drained potatoes and mixed with chopped fresh parsley. Half of the cooked bacon is folded in immediately, and the remaining bacon is used as garnish. The result is a warm, slightly sweet and tangy salad combining tender potatoes with the smoky flavor of bacon and bite from onions, seasoned with celery seed and black pepper.

This salad is commonly served warm and pairs well with hearty meals and grilled dishes. Its combination of flavors and temperature distinguishes it from mayonnaise-based potato salads.

Ingredients

Servings
  • 2 pounds potato cut into 1" chunks, red
  • 8 lices Bacon , diced
  • 1 yellow onion , diced
  • 1/4 cup white vinegar
  • 2 tablespoons sugar
  • 2 tablespoons water
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1 teaspoon celery seed
  • 1/4 teaspoon black pepper coarse ground
  • 1/4 cup parsley , chopped

Instructions

  1. Add the potatoes to a large pot covered with cold water and bring to a boil and cook for an additional 12-15 minutes or until you can easily pierce the potato with a small knife.
  2. In a large skillet cook the bacon on medium heat until crispy, then remove.
  3. Discard all but 4 tablespoons of bacon fat, then add the onion to the remaining bacon fat in the pan and cook on medium heat until it just starts to brown, about 4-5 minutes, stirring occasionally.
  4. Add in the vinegar, water, sugar, salt, celery seed and pepper and stir together until the mixture is boiling and the sugar is dissolved.
  5. Put the potatoes in a large mixing bowl, pour over the onion mixture and add in the parsley.
  6. Gently toss the mixture together until most of the dressing is absorbed then add in half the bacon toss together another few seconds and garnish with remaining bacon before serving.
